Willie D. Clark was indicted on 39 counts for his alleged involvement in the murder of the Denver Bronco's corner back Darrent Williams.
Williams was shot and killed while riding in a rented limousine during the early hours of New Years Day, 2007. He was leaving the Safari Club...

At the end of the 2006 season, one thing was certain, the Oakland Raiders had no offensive line. After letting up an astronomical and league high 72 sacks during the year, the entire offensive coaching staff was replaced. Even longtime Raiders player and coach, Fred Biletnikoff, retired...
